MUMBAI, India, April 17 -- Intellectual Property India has published a patent application (202621022878 A) filed by Ritesh Kumar Verma, Bhopal, Madhya Pradesh, on Feb. 26, for 'a data-driven model for assessing credit risk of small and medium enterprises (smes) in india using financial, behavioral, and macroeconomic indicators.'
Inventor(s) include Ritesh Kumar Verma.
The application for the patent was published on April 17, under issue no. 16/2026.
